From 3892e4dd611efca396aa2d5dd606ace625e0d315 Mon Sep 17 00:00:00 2001 From: Edward Hervey Date: Sat, 28 Sep 2013 08:40:42 +0200 Subject: [PATCH] pluginloader: Check errors on the proper fd Most likely a copy-paste error from the block before. If we're going to check for error/closed on the write fd... do it on the write fd --- gst/gstpluginloader.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/gst/gstpluginloader.c b/gst/gstpluginloader.c index b1bdcea..d33dc69 100644 --- a/gst/gstpluginloader.c +++ b/gst/gstpluginloader.c @@ -1011,7 +1011,7 @@ exchange_packets (GstPluginLoader * l) if (l->tx_buf_read < l->tx_buf_write) { if (gst_poll_fd_has_error (l->fdset, &l->fd_w) || - gst_poll_fd_has_closed (l->fdset, &l->fd_r)) { + gst_poll_fd_has_closed (l->fdset, &l->fd_w)) { GST_ERROR ("write fd %d closed/errored", l->fd_w.fd); goto fail_and_cleanup; } -- 2.7.4